mysql会给主键自动建立索引吗? 如题 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 我的意思是,比如说:如果将用户名作为主键,在查询用户名时,假设用户名没有索引,就会很慢,而Oracle数据库就会在建立主键的同时对其建立索引,这样查询就会比较快。因此我想问一下,mysql有没有这个功能。 主健 本来就是索引哈!mysql> show index from usernumber;+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+| usernumber | 0 | PRIMARY | 1 | id | A | 0 | NULL | NULL | | BTREE | |+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+1 row in set (0.00 sec) 在MYSQL中,当你建立主键时,索引同时也已建立起来了。不必重复设置 mysql用sql语句怎样显示一个日期区间的每天日期 关于级联问题,请高手解答 用SQL语句找出不相邻的数据 请问一个数据库设计问题,希望能保证一致性的同时,保证查询速度 为什么我的mysql表记录数一超过400万就会有奇怪的问题 关于distinct的问题 请问重装系统后如何才能访问之前建立的表? 請問在windows下如何連接linux下的MYSQL請大家推荐几個好工具﹐不知道有沒有 windows下大数据 如何备份 Mysql Innodb怎么分表? 在使用MySQL时如何更改数据库名及表名?在线等待。。。 谁能给我个这样的查询语句?
+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|
+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
| usernumber | 0 | PRIMARY | 1 | id | A | 0 | NULL | NULL | | BTREE | |
+------------+------------+----------+--------------+-------------+-----------+-------------+----------+--------+------+------------+---------+
1 row in set (0.00 sec)
不必重复设置